**About Thorncliffe Park Women’s Committee**:
The Thorncliffe Park Women’s Committee is a grassroots organization dedicated since 2008 to creating healthy and vibrant communities by implementing public space enhancement projects and empowering women by providing opportunities of engagement and integration through capacity-building, education, entrepreneurship and civic participation in Thorncliffe Park neighbourhood. Projects have included the rejuvenation of the local RV Burgess Park, North America’s first ever outdoor Tandoor Oven, running the Friday Night Community Market, Youth Ravine Stewardship Program, the Community Gardens, and most recently, pivoting during the pandemic to create the Neighbours in Need program delivering hot culturally appropriate meals made at the Park Cafe.
